Transponder Key

Transponder chips are almost always present in cars manufactured in the last 20 years. They add a layer how to unlock skoda octavia without key security and can help prevent your vehicle from being stolen. They are also much harder to duplicate than regular keys, so you can be sure nobody else will be able start your vehicle.

Transponder keys work by sending a unique coded signal from the chip to the antenna of your vehicle when you insert the key. The car then uses this information to determine whether or not it is a valid key, and allows you to start your engine. Transponder chips have become an industry standard to protect your car from theft.

Remote Control Key

Key fobs are small device that lets you unlock and lock your car remotely. It can also start the vehicle and operate electrical components. In certain situations, the remote control key may cease to function due to an issue with the car's electronic system. If this happens you can reset your key with an OBDII scanner.

A dead battery can cause a key fob that is not working to. A fresh battery should give you several years of trouble-free operation, however if you've replaced the older one with a brand new model and it still doesn't work, then the issue isn't the battery. Make sure you replace the battery with a brand new one that's the exact same size as well as voltage and type as the original.

Water damage can cause the fob's key to cease working. If the fob was exposed to water that was clean or rain and you are unable to revive it by cleaning the chip with alcohol and isopropyl and drying it completely before replacing the battery. If the fob was exposed soapy water or salt, it's probably damaged and you'll have to purchase a new battery from an authorized dealer.

Key Fob

You can fix your car key fob if it fails to function. Depending on the root cause of the problem, you might need to replace the battery, reprogramme the remote keyless system receiver module or both. You can also try a spare key made of metal which is embedded in the fob itself. If this doesn't work, it may be time to visit a dealer to make repairs.

The most frequent reason for a key fob's device to stop working is the battery has died. The flat disc battery (CR2025 or CR2032) is located inside the transmitter portion of the fob. The key fob is simple to replace - just remove the transmitter component using a screwdriver in the area marked with an arrow. Take off the battery that is flat and replace it with an alternative one, making sure that the positive side of the new battery is facing upwards.

The key fob is equipped with metal retaining clips that hold the battery in place and complete the circuit. If they're not secure, it can cause poor contact and stop the remote from receiving commands. Verify the battery's contact points using an instrument such as a voltage or multimeter to ensure they are in good condition. If they're not, the transmitter module or electronic chip is the problem.
